Tethered and anchored scars, with areas of atrophy. You have several options, but I think surgical subcsion with or without PRP is the first step. Filler in this area can help with superficial and deep. Hard to say with just one snap shot, but this is where cautious use of fat transfer can help due to the sheer volume loss. Other options include microneedling RF - remember scars are 3 D, hit vertically and horizontally ( subcision) for best outcomes. I think one stand out feature is the atrophic nature (fat loss and connective tissue- collagen, elastin, matrix etc) of your scars. Should be a straight forward procedure for scar specialists. The faq is the very first post in the acne scar sub check it out, the other link posted above is old information.

You have icepicks and box cars.

I would do subcision only with a nokor needle. IT will take a few of them. I would also do rf microneedle called infini rf or vivance., again a few of them. Finally I would do spot TCA peels on this area for texture. Acne scars are never one and done, it will take up to 3 years of treatments with down time. I have seen good results with many using these treatments on the temple area. You can read more about those treatments in the faq.
